Pucharich burns B.A.R.F. Enduro By D uane Eller BLAC K RIV ER FAL LS, WI , J ULY 19 . Dave P ucha rich anihi lated the com pet it io n with Dav e Mun genast's CR250 Honda during th e sweltering sec o nd loop of t he 8t h An n ual B.A.R.F. Enduro. H ig h point A winn er J eff Ha asl . o n a CR500 H o nda, had a two poin t lead o n Pucharich a fter th e first loo p. Never the less. the 90° tempera tu res a nd 20 mi le woods sectio ns ca used Haa sl to drop I W O ex tra points in the seco nd loop, while P ucha rich improved his score by two points to cla im a victory with 25 poi nts (versus Haasl' s 27 po ints ). La st yea r's winn er, Joe Zierrnan. borrowed a YZ490 to top Open A with a 29 poi nt total. Zierman wou ld have been mor e in the h u nt . had he no t burned the first check by one min u te. He a lso fou nd th a t open bi kes can be tempermenta l when stalled; he had a cons iderable p ro blem sta rti n g it o n a t leas t one occasion th at cost him ex tra points. T he race dav started o ut wi th coo l temperatures a nd a q uarter in ch of rai n that ma de exce llent ridi ng co ndi tio ns th e first time arou nd the 47.5 grou nd mil e loo p , bu t the temperature rose rapid ly in th e ea rly afternoon to abo ut 900. A 10 mile reset in the middle of the loop put 90%of th e riders back o n time. Riders commented that the arrowing was exce llent, considering that the Madison M.e. spe nt the p revious day" franticall y repl acing abou t 60%of th e arrows that had been eaten off th e trees by grassho p pe rs.
